study guides for every class

that actually explain what's on your next test

Dynamic Power Management

from class:

Formal Verification of Hardware

Definition

Dynamic Power Management (DPM) refers to the techniques used in electronic devices, particularly in processors, to optimize energy consumption by adjusting power usage based on the workload and operating conditions. This allows systems to minimize power consumption during idle times while providing sufficient performance when needed, contributing to improved energy efficiency and thermal management.

congrats on reading the definition of Dynamic Power Management.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Dynamic Power Management can significantly reduce power consumption in processors by scaling back resources when full performance is not necessary.
  2. DPM techniques can include putting idle components into low-power states and adjusting the operating frequency and voltage of the processor.
  3. Effective DPM can lead to extended battery life in portable devices, making it essential for mobile computing.
  4. DPM mechanisms often rely on real-time monitoring of workloads and system demands to make immediate adjustments.
  5. The implementation of DPM can also improve thermal performance, reducing overheating risks by managing power usage.

Review Questions

  • How does Dynamic Power Management contribute to the overall energy efficiency of processors?
    • Dynamic Power Management enhances energy efficiency in processors by allowing them to adjust their power consumption according to real-time workload demands. When the processor is idle or under low load, DPM techniques reduce power use by transitioning components into low-power states or lowering voltage and frequency. This flexibility not only saves energy but also helps maintain optimal thermal conditions, thereby prolonging the device's lifespan and improving performance.
  • Discuss the role of Voltage Scaling in conjunction with Dynamic Power Management and how they can work together.
    • Voltage Scaling plays a crucial role in Dynamic Power Management by allowing systems to adjust the voltage supplied to components based on their performance needs. When combined with DPM techniques, Voltage Scaling enables a more granular approach to power management, as it can lower energy use even further without sacrificing performance. By dynamically altering both voltage and operational states, processors can efficiently meet varying workload requirements while conserving energy.
  • Evaluate the challenges and benefits of implementing Dynamic Power Management in modern processors.
    • Implementing Dynamic Power Management in modern processors presents both challenges and benefits. On the one hand, DPM can lead to significant energy savings and enhanced thermal management, crucial for battery-operated devices. However, challenges include the complexity of accurately monitoring workloads and system behavior to make effective real-time adjustments. Additionally, improper implementation may lead to performance bottlenecks if power management decisions are not aligned with application demands, emphasizing the need for sophisticated algorithms and control mechanisms.

"Dynamic Power Management" also found in:

©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.